SOMERSET, NJ - Permabond Engineering Adhesives launched an enhanced version of their product brochure. This newest edition of the brochure contains new products and increased temperature limits for existing products. Easier to read charts and graphs of a vast array of data related to product selection and usage recommendations are included. Adhesion, strength, flexibility, thermal expansion, environmental and chemical compatibility, and many more topics are covered. The brochure provides guidance for industrial use of adhesives and sealants on metal, plastic, composite, and glass components.

About Permabond
Permabond develops and manufactures engineering adhesives and sealants for assembly, manufacturing, repair, and maintenance. Permabond offers custom formulating for unique requirements. Products are sold worldwide through authorized distributors. ISO 9001:2008
